在当今数字化时代,网络安全问题日益严峻,DDoS(分布式拒绝服务)攻击作为一种常见且具有严重破坏力的网络攻击手段,给众多企业和机构带来了巨大的威胁。为了有效应对DDoS攻击,流量清洗技术应运而生。本文将深入探讨流量清洗技术的原理与应用实践,帮助读者更好地理解和运用这一技术来保障网络安全。
一、DDoS攻击概述
DDoS攻击是指攻击者通过控制大量的傀儡主机(僵尸网络),向目标服务器或网络发送海量的请求,从而耗尽目标系统的资源,使其无法正常提供服务。常见的DDoS攻击类型包括带宽耗尽型攻击、协议攻击和应用层攻击等。带宽耗尽型攻击主要通过发送大量的无用数据包,占用网络带宽,使合法用户无法正常访问;协议攻击则是利用网络协议的漏洞,发送恶意的协议数据包,导致目标系统崩溃;应用层攻击则是针对应用程序的漏洞,通过大量的请求使应用程序无法正常响应。
二、流量清洗技术的原理
流量清洗技术的核心原理是通过对网络流量进行实时监测和分析,识别出其中的攻击流量,并将其从正常流量中分离出来,然后对攻击流量进行过滤和清洗,最后将清洗后的正常流量转发到目标服务器。具体来说,流量清洗技术主要包括以下几个步骤:
1. 流量监测:通过部署在网络边界的监测设备,实时采集网络流量数据,并对其进行分析和统计。监测设备可以是硬件设备,也可以是软件系统。
2. 攻击识别:利用预设的规则和算法,对监测到的流量数据进行分析和比对,识别出其中的攻击流量。常见的攻击识别方法包括基于特征的识别、基于行为的识别和基于机器学习的识别等。
3. 流量牵引:当识别出攻击流量后,将其从正常流量中分离出来,并牵引到专门的清洗设备进行处理。流量牵引可以通过路由策略、防火墙规则等方式实现。
4. 流量清洗:在清洗设备中,对牵引过来的攻击流量进行过滤和清洗,去除其中的恶意数据包。清洗设备可以采用多种技术,如黑洞路由、过滤规则、流量整形等。
5. 流量回注:将清洗后的正常流量重新注入到原网络中,使其能够正常访问目标服务器。流量回注可以通过路由策略、防火墙规则等方式实现。
三、流量清洗技术的应用实践
流量清洗技术在实际应用中具有广泛的应用场景,下面将介绍一些常见的应用实践。
1. 企业网络防护:企业网络是DDoS攻击的主要目标之一,通过部署流量清洗设备,可以有效保护企业网络免受DDoS攻击的影响。企业可以根据自身的网络规模和安全需求,选择合适的流量清洗设备和部署方式。
2. 数据中心防护:数据中心是企业的核心业务支撑平台,一旦受到DDoS攻击,将导致企业的业务中断,造成巨大的损失。通过在数据中心部署流量清洗设备,可以有效保护数据中心的安全。数据中心可以采用分布式部署的方式,将流量清洗设备部署在多个网络节点上,以提高防护能力。
3. 云服务提供商防护:云服务提供商为众多企业和用户提供云计算服务,一旦受到DDoS攻击,将影响众多用户的正常使用。云服务提供商可以通过部署大规模的流量清洗设备,为用户提供DDoS防护服务。云服务提供商可以采用集中式部署的方式,将流量清洗设备部署在数据中心的核心位置,以提高防护效率。
4. 政府机构防护:政府机构的网络安全关系到国家的安全和稳定,一旦受到DDoS攻击,将造成严重的后果。政府机构可以通过部署流量清洗设备,加强对自身网络的防护。政府机构可以采用与专业的网络安全服务提供商合作的方式,获取更加专业的DDoS防护服务。
四、流量清洗技术的发展趋势
随着网络技术的不断发展和DDoS攻击手段的不断升级,流量清洗技术也在不断发展和创新。未来,流量清洗技术将呈现以下几个发展趋势:
1. 智能化:随着人工智能和机器学习技术的不断发展,流量清洗技术将越来越智能化。通过利用人工智能和机器学习算法,可以更加准确地识别攻击流量,提高清洗效率。
2. 分布式:随着网络规模的不断扩大和DDoS攻击的分布式化,流量清洗技术将越来越分布式化。通过在多个网络节点上部署流量清洗设备,可以提高防护能力和响应速度。
3. 云化:随着云计算技术的不断发展,流量清洗技术将越来越云化。通过将流量清洗服务部署在云端,可以为用户提供更加便捷、高效的DDoS防护服务。
4. 融合化:随着网络安全技术的不断发展,流量清洗技术将与其他网络安全技术进行融合。例如,将流量清洗技术与防火墙、入侵检测系统等技术进行融合,可以提高网络安全防护的整体能力。
五、总结
流量清洗技术作为一种有效的DDoS攻击防护手段,在网络安全领域具有重要的应用价值。通过对网络流量进行实时监测和分析,识别出其中的攻击流量,并将其从正常流量中分离出来,然后对攻击流量进行过滤和清洗,最后将清洗后的正常流量转发到目标服务器,可以有效保护网络免受DDoS攻击的影响。未来,随着网络技术的不断发展和DDoS攻击手段的不断升级,流量清洗技术也将不断发展和创新,为网络安全提供更加可靠的保障。